Ultimate guide to home page configuration

Your program’s home page is the starting point for users to log in or register. Good Grants gives you the flexibility to customise this page with branding, featured categories, public galleries, and more.

Enable or disable registration

You can control whether new users can register. To toggle registration:

  1. In the Manage workspace, go to Settings > Users > Registration
  2. Select or deselect Enable user registration
  3. Click Save

Configure branding

You can add logos, images and colours to your home page through the theme settings in Settings > General > Theme. Branding elements include:

  • Home logo for desktop
  • Home logo for mobile
  • Home background image
  • Footer image
  • Colours

Recommended dimensions are included below.

Home logo (desktop)

  • Appears when users visit your program on a desktop or large tablet
  • Can be aligned left, centre, or right
  • Displays at the exact size of the uploaded file

Recommended dimensions: 700 × 250 px

Home logo (mobile)

  • Appears when users visit your program on a mobile device
  • Can be aligned left, centre, or right
  • Displays at the exact size of the uploaded file

Recommended dimensions: 300 × 200 px

Home background image

  • Fills the available background space on the login page
  • Automatically cropped to match screen size

Recommended dimensions: 1920 × 1000 px

Content blocks

Two content blocks can appear on the home page

  • Home page description
  • Home header info box

These can be edited or added in Settings > Content > Content blocks.

If your program includes a public About page, a link to this page will also appear on the home page.

Display category on home page

You can highlight a category on your login page.

  1. In the Manage workspace, go to Settings > Applications > Categories
  2. Select the category
  3. Under 'Display category on public home page', select Yes
  4. Select Save

Good to know

  • Theme customisation varies by subscription level.
  • Image optimisation may reduce asset quality slightly to ensure fast loading.
  • Home logos are not scaled and appear at the uploaded size.
  • Cropping of images may occur depending on user device and browser size.
  • Content blocks provide flexible ways to add information to your home page.
  • Public galleries require the Premium plan or above.
  • The About page link appears automatically when the page is visible to all roles.
  • SSO and 3rd party authentication options are configured separately.
